Tencent Cloud CFS and Java docking: How to achieve highly reliable and high-performance file storage?
Introduction: With the popularity of cloud computing technology, more and more applications store data on the cloud. Tencent Cloud CFS (Cloud File Storage) is a distributed file storage service that supports high reliability and high performance. This article will introduce how to use Java to connect with Tencent Cloud CFS to achieve highly reliable and high-performance file storage.
1. Preparation
- Obtain the access key (secretId and secretKey) of Tencent Cloud CFS.
- Add the Java SDK dependency of Tencent Cloud CFS in the Maven or Gradle configuration file.
2. Create a file system
First, we need to create a file system on the Tencent Cloud console. Log in to the Tencent Cloud CFS console and click "Create File System" in "File System List". Set the name, capacity, VPC to which the file system belongs, etc., and confirm the creation.
3. Initialize COS client
COS (Cloud Object Storage) is an object storage service provided by Tencent Cloud and serves as the back-end storage of CFS. We need to initialize the COS client before we can use CFS related functions.
The following is a sample code to initialize the COS client:
import com.qcloud.cos.COSClient; import com.qcloud.cos.ClientConfig; import com.qcloud.cos.auth.BasicCOSCredentials; import com.qcloud.cos.region.Region; public class COSClientUtil { private static final String ACCESS_KEY = "your-access-key"; private static final String SECRET_KEY = "your-secret-key"; private static final String REGION = "your-region"; public static COSClient getCOSClient() { BasicCOSCredentials cred = new BasicCOSCredentials(ACCESS_KEY, SECRET_KEY); Region region = new Region(REGION); ClientConfig clientConfig = new ClientConfig(region); return new COSClient(cred, clientConfig); } }
Please replace your-access-key, your-secret-key and your-region with your real values. The COSClientUtil.getCOSClient() method returns an initialized COSClient instance.
4. Interconnection between Java and Tencent Cloud CFS
The key to using Tencent Cloud CFS in Java is to operate files through the COS client. For example, operations such as uploading files, downloading files, and deleting files are all implemented through the COS client.
The following is a sample code for uploading files to CFS:
import com.qcloud.cos.COSClient; import com.qcloud.cos.model.*; public class CFSClientUtil { private static final String BUCKET_NAME = "your-bucket-name"; private static final String CFS_MOUNT_PATH = "/your-cfs-mount-path"; public static void uploadFileToCFS(COSClient cosClient, String localFilePath, String cfsFilePath) { String key = CFS_MOUNT_PATH + cfsFilePath; PutObjectRequest putObjectRequest = new PutObjectRequest(BUCKET_NAME, key, new File(localFilePath)); cosClient.putObject(putObjectRequest); } }
Please replace your-bucket-name and your-cfs-mount-path with your real values. The CFSClientUtil.uploadFileToCFS() method is used to upload local files to CFS.
